  • Patent number: 10922510
    Abstract: A method for detecting optical codes comprises an input image being provided. Optical codes in the input image are detected by generating an output image on the basis of the input image. Within generating the output image, pixels of an area of the input image comprising a part of an optical code are assigned a first intensity in the output image. Within generating the output image, pixels of an area of the input image e.g. comprising no part of an optical code are assigned a second intensity in the output image. Regions of the output image with the first intensity are provided for determining properties of the detected optical codes.

  • Patent number: 10782667
    Abstract: In a real-time environment at least one task is executed with a pre-defined task run-time, wherein at least one auxiliary function with indeterminate function run-time is to be processed within the specified task run-time by means of a time monitoring function. The time monitoring function, which defines a termination time for the auxiliary function within the pre-defined task run-time, is started. Then the auxiliary function is executed, wherein the time monitoring function monitors the function run-time and a function abort is initiated if the pre-defined abort time point is exceeded. Finally, the time monitoring function is terminated.
